**TCS Receives 21.16 Acres in Visakhapatnam to Boost Tech Hub**
The Andhra Pradesh government has granted Tata Consultancy Services (TCS) the allocation of 21.16 acres of land at a nominal price of just 99 paise, aiming to establish Visakhapatnam as a burgeoning technology hub. This land, situated at IT Hill Number 3 in Vizag, will serve as the site for TCS’s new IT campus. The state cabinet approved this initiative on Tuesday, projecting an investment of approximately Rs 1,370 crore and the creation of nearly 12,000 jobs.
The cabinet’s announcement emphasized the significance of this project in enhancing Visakhapatnam’s appeal as a prime destination for IT companies and digital services. The discussions to bring TCS to Vizag began in October 2024, when state IT Minister Nara Lokesh met with senior Tata Group officials in Mumbai, inviting them to consider Andhra Pradesh for their next major venture. Since then, the state government has engaged in ongoing negotiations with TCS to finalize the project details.
Offering land at such a symbolic rate is a strategic move to signal to the tech industry that Andhra Pradesh is open for substantial investments and is committed to supporting IT firms. Nara Lokesh, the Minister for Human Resource Development, highlighted this initiative at the India Today Conclave 2025, stating, “We are at the cusp of a new revolution. States that position themselves with quality manpower and an enabling ecosystem can move ahead swiftly. Andhra Pradesh is at the right point to take that leap.” He underscored the state’s competitive efforts to attract investments and technological advancements.
Additionally, the Andhra Pradesh government has announced plans for a 500-acre Data City near Visakhapatnam, aiming to replicate the success of Hyderabad’s Hitec City. The decision to allocate land to TCS at 99 paise echoes a similar strategy employed in Gujarat, where Tata Motors was given land for the same price, significantly contributing to the state’s automotive industry growth. This approach indicates Andhra Pradesh’s commitment to fostering long-term technology investments.
